Solution for 4(v-14)=16 equation:



4(v-14)=16
We move all terms to the left:
4(v-14)-(16)=0
We multiply parentheses
4v-56-16=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
4v-72=0
We move all terms containing v to the left, all other terms to the right
4v=72
v=72/4
v=18
